Proposal
Outline application (all matters reserved) for the construction of single storey dwelling, a workshop and garage, two Apiary enclosures, wild flower meadow and Eucalyptus plantation for the production of specialist honey based products.
As published by the council, reference 2025/5282/OUT

About outline applications
An outline application tests the principle of developing a site, holding back details such as appearance and landscaping as reserved matters for later approval. More in our guide to planning application types.
